The following email was received in response to a listing on an Au Pair website. This is a scam, no vacancy exists the scammer will try an scam you out of money by asking for fees or travel costs or accomodation costs.

Dear Au Pair/ Nanny,
I am Mr. Alan Coley, from the United Kingdom I work with Multimedia Consultant in United Kingdom and I don't usually stay home unless during weekends. My contact address is 10 Arran Hill, Thrybergh, Rotherham, South Yorkshire, S65 4BH and I will like you to know that I have just two kids which names are Mike and Nick and there ages are 3 years and 5 years old. I want an Au Pair nanny for them because they are the only one left at home after their Mother divorced me for another man.
Your duties will be taking the kids to school and bringing them back home, play with them, go to museums, playground, watching movies, prepare/serving their snacks and foods. You will have your Private Room which will have Bathroom, Toilet, Television, and Air-Conditional. You will have access to the Internet and a Telephone at home to get in touch with your friends and loved ones. You will be having Fridays, Saturdays and Sundays as your off days, so to enable you have enough time for yourself. As for your salary, I will be paying you 2,000Pounds every 4 weeks and a pocket fee of 300 Pounds weekly which I suppose should be Okay by you and as regard to my family picture, I have attached them for you to see Okay...
